anyone who hasn't used the new KO2s is missing out. There are some great tires out there, but for noise/wear/aggressiveness as a combination, nothing is even close right now in my opinion. I have put 13k on my 275/70/18s that are on my 200 and they are wearing like iron at 38psi. My 80 and GX have them as well. My 100 did have them and with 10k they still looked brand new. I cant recommend them highly enough for anyone looking for any need minus a super aggressive mud tire.

I have this exact setup... 34/10.5/17 with the spacers. Truth be told, they are nowhere near 34's. But, after 10k miles with very little wear, I'm still very happy with them. No complaints at all. Will I buy them again? Probably not, but I have yet to buy the same tire twice and will probably go with some real 34's next time. Only to change things up.
